About Bali Bintang Sejahtera Tbk

PT Bali Bintang Sejahtera (“the Company”) was established based on notarial deed No. 3 dated 3 December 2014 by Yurisa Martanti, S.H., M.H., notary in Jakarta. By the end of 2014, the Company acquired the business of Football Club Putra Samarinda (Pusam). In 2015, the Company has moved its home base club to Stadion Kapten I Wayan Dipta, Gianyar, Bali,Indonesia and registered its club in the Indonesia Football League with the name of Bali United Pusam. Furthermore in 2016, the Company has changed the registration of the name with the name of Bali United. Currently, the Company is taking care of the registration of a trademark rights and professional football club manager and Official Store "Bali United".

About Gajah Tunggal Tbk.

PT. Gajah Tunggal, Tbk (the Company) was established based on notarial deed No. 54 dated August 24, 1951 of Raden Meester Soewandi, S.H., notary public in Jakarta. The Company is the largest tire manufacturer in Indonesia with 32% market share of four-wheel vehicle tire market and 85% of the motorcycle tire market.
